[Detailed Description of the Invention] [Industrial Application Field] The present invention relates to an inflatable pneumatic table that is used to float on the surface of water in pools, hot springs, etc.

In order to explain the embodiment of the present invention in accordance with the manufacturing method, first, a large hole 2 is formed at the center of a circular top plate 1 made of a transparent thermoplastic soft synthetic resin sheet, and small holes 3 are formed at numerous locations around the periphery. holes 2 and 3 below each of the large hole 2 and small hole 3.
The upper half members 4 and 5 for forming a recess made of opaque thermoplastic soft synthetic resin sheets having a donut shape with the same inner diameter are overlapped, and the inner peripheral edge of each upper half member 4 and 5 is connected to the incisal edge of each hole 2 and 3. air-tightly high-frequency welded.

然るのち、各上半部材4,5の下側に不透明熱
可塑性軟質合成樹脂シート製の凹部形成用下半部
材6,7を重合してこれ等上半部材4,5、下半
部材6,7の全外周縁を相互に気密に熔着する。
Thereafter, lower half members 6 and 7 for forming recesses made of an opaque thermoplastic soft synthetic resin sheet are superimposed on the lower side of each upper half member 4 and 5 to form the upper half members 4 and 5 and the lower half member 6. , 7 are hermetically welded together.

次いで、上記の上面版1を不透明熱可塑性軟質
合成樹脂シート製の円形下面版8の上に重合し、
この下面版8と上記の下半部材6,7とを円線上
個所9に於て相互に気密に熔着する。
Next, the above-mentioned upper plate 1 is superposed on a circular lower plate 8 made of an opaque thermoplastic soft synthetic resin sheet,
This lower plate 8 and the lower half members 6, 7 are hermetically welded to each other at a circular point 9.

然るのち、これ等とは別個に不透明熱可塑性軟
質合成樹脂シート製帯状版の両端縁を相互に高周
波熔着して環状の側面版10を構成し、この側面
版10の所要個所に送排気栓11を取付けると共
にこの側面版10を上記の上面版1と下面版8と
の間に挾入して当該側面版10の上側縁と上面版
1の外周縁および同側面版10の下側縁と下面版
8の外周縁を夫々相互に気密に高周波熔着し、仍
つて膨張時に盤形状を呈する膨縮自在の空気入り
テーブル主部12と上記の小さい孔3を開口とす
る筒状のコツプ、ビン等差立用凹部13と上記の
大きい孔2を開口とする筒状のアイス・クーラー
用凹部14とを備えたテーブルを完成するように
したものである。
After that, separately from these, both ends of a band-shaped plate made of an opaque thermoplastic soft synthetic resin sheet are welded together using high frequency to form an annular side plate 10, and the side plate 10 is blown and vented to required locations. At the same time as installing the plug 11, this side plate 10 is inserted between the above-mentioned upper surface plate 1 and lower surface plate 8, and the upper edge of the side plate 10, the outer peripheral edge of the upper surface plate 1, and the lower side edge of the same side plate 10. The outer peripheral edges of the upper and lower plates 8 are airtightly welded to each other by high frequency welding, and the main part 12 of the air-filled table, which can be expanded and contracted to take on a disk shape when expanded, and the cylindrical cup having the above-mentioned small hole 3 as an opening are formed. , a table is completed which is provided with a recess 13 for holding bottles, etc., and a cylindrical ice cooler recess 14 having the above-mentioned large hole 2 as an opening.
